Boosting Sewage Treatment Plant Performance from Ground Zero
Successfully launching a high-performing sewage treatment plant hinges on strategic planning and execution from the very inception. This involves rigorously assessing local wastewater characteristics to select the most suitable treatment technology. Factors like flow rate, pollutant types, and legal norms must be precisely considered. Furthermore, implementing a robust tracking network is vital for continuous efficiency assessment. Regular servicing and modifications based on results are essential to optimizing treatment effectiveness.

Addressing Community Needs: Sewage Treatment Plant Construction and Commissioning
The construction of a new sewage treatment plant is a major undertaking that directly impacts the health of a community. This endeavor requires careful strategy to ensure its effectiveness in processing wastewater and safeguarding the natural world.
A phased approach to deployment is often adopted, beginning with a thorough analysis of existing infrastructure and community demands. This stage involves identifying the amount of wastewater generated and designing a treatment system that meets regulatory requirements.
The building phase ensues, which involves the setting up of machinery and the assembly of filtering units. This phase frequently requires meticulous collaboration between architects, contractors, and local regulators.
Finally, the startup phase involves verifying all elements to ensure they function efficiently according to requirements. This phase also includes training plant operators and staff on the proper management of the facility.
Successful sewage treatment plant establishment and commissioning are essential for improving public well-being, protecting the environment, and ensuring sustainable growth within a community.
